Midjouery:轻量级JavaScript库概述

在现代Web开发中,JavaScript已经成为最常用的编程语言之一。为了使JavaScript的开发更加高效和优雅,许多开发者开始使用不同的JavaScript库和框架。这里我们将重点介绍Midjouery——一款快速、小巧且易于使用的JavaScript库。

一、创建HTML元素

Midjouery可以帮助开发人员轻松地创建和修改HTML元素。下面是一个简单的例子:

// 创建一个新的段落
var $myParagraph = midjouery('

');// 添加文本节点$myParagraph.text('Hello, World!');// 将段落添加到文档中midjouery(document.body).append($myParagraph);

在上面的例子中,我们使用Midjouery函数来创建一个新的段落元素。然后,我们使用.text()方法将文本添加到段落中。最后,我们使用.append()方法将段落添加到文档的body中。

二、处理事件

Midjouery允许您使用简单且易于维护的代码来处理事件。下面是一个例子:

// 选择一个按钮
var $myButton = midjouery('#my-button');

// 添加点击事件处理程序
$myButton.on('click', function() {
    alert('Button clicked!');
});

在上面的例子中,我们使用Midjouery函数选择了一个DOM元素。然后,我们使用.on()方法为该元素添加了一个点击事件处理程序。当按钮被点击时,我们将弹出一个警告窗口。

三、动画效果

Midjouery使动画的实现变得非常简单。下面是一个例子:

// 选择一个DIV元素
var $myDiv = midjouery('#my-div');

// 在1秒内向上滑动100个像素
$myDiv.animate({
    top: '-=100px'
}, 1000);

在上面的例子中,我们使用Midjouery函数选择了一个DIV元素。然后,我们使用.animate()方法来实现向上滑动的动画效果。在1秒内,该DIV元素将向上移动100个像素。

四、Ajax请求

Midjouery使Ajax请求变得非常简单。下面是一个例子:

// 从服务器获取数据
midjouery.get('/api/data', function(data) {
    // 在控制台上显示响应的数据
    console.log(data);
});

在上面的例子中,我们使用Midjouery的.get()方法从服务器获取数据。当响应到达时,将会执行回调函数,并在控制台上显示响应的数据。

五、插件

Midjouery拥有许多优秀的插件,它们可以帮助您实现更多的功能或增强Midjouery自身的功能。下面是一个例子:

// 使用Midjouery插件来创建轮播图
midjouery('.my-carousel').carousel();

在上面的例子中,我们使用Midjouery的carousel插件来创建轮播图。

六、结论

Midjouery是一个快速、小巧且容易使用的JavaScript库。它可以帮助您轻松地创建和修改HTML元素,处理事件,实现动画效果,进行Ajax请求,并提供许多有用的插件。如果您正在寻找一种简单但功能强大的JavaScript库,Midjouery绝对值得一试。

原创文章,作者:PKKKM,如若转载,请注明出处:https://www.506064.com/n/369724.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
PKKKM的头像PKKKM
上一篇 2025-04-13 11:45
下一篇 2025-04-13 11:45

相关推荐

  • 使用JavaScript日期函数掌握时间

    在本文中,我们将深入探讨JavaScript日期函数,并且从多个视角介绍其应用方法和重要性。 一、日期的基本表示与获取 在JavaScript中,使用Date对象来表示日期和时间,…

    编程 2025-04-28
  • JavaScript中使用new Date转换为YYYYMMDD格式

    在JavaScript中,我们通常会使用Date对象来表示日期和时间。当我们需要在网站上显示日期时,很多情况下需要将Date对象转换成YYYYMMDD格式的字符串。下面我们来详细了…

    编程 2025-04-27
  • JavaScript中修改style属性的方法和技巧

    一、基本概念和方法 style属性是JavaScript中一个非常重要的属性,它可以用来控制HTML元素的样式,包括颜色、大小、字体等等。这里介绍一些常用的方法: 1、通过Java…

    编程 2025-04-25
  • CloneDeep函数在Javascript开发中的应用

    一、CloneDeep的概念 CloneDeep函数在Javascript中是一种深层克隆对象的方法,可以在拷贝对象时避免出现引用关系。使用者可以在函数中设置可选参数使其满足多种拷…

    编程 2025-04-25
  • JavaScript中的Object.getOwnPropertyDescriptors()

    一、简介 Object.getOwnPropertyDescriptors()是JavaScript中一个非常有用的工具。简单来说,这个方法可以获取一个对象上所有自有属性的属性描述…

    编程 2025-04-25
  • JavaScript保留整数的完整指南

    JavaScript是一种通用脚本语言,非常适合Web应用程序开发。在处理数字时,JavaScript可以处理整数和浮点数。在本文中,我们将重点关注JavaScript如何保留整数…

    编程 2025-04-25
  • JavaScript点击事件全方位指南

    一、click事件基础 click事件是最常用的鼠标事件之一,当元素被单击时触发。click事件适用于大多数HTML元素(<a>、<button>)和SVG…

    编程 2025-04-25
  • 详解JavaScript onclick事件

    一、onclick的基础知识 onclick事件是JavaScript中最常用的事件之一,它在用户点击某个HTML元素时触发。通常我们可以通过给元素添加一个onclick属性来绑定…

    编程 2025-04-25
  • JavaScript浅拷贝

    一、什么是浅拷贝 在JavaScript中,浅拷贝是一种将源对象的属性复制到目标对象中的方法。浅拷贝的实现方式有多种,包括直接赋值、Object.assign()、展开运算符、co…

    编程 2025-04-25
  • JavaScript 数组转成字符串

    一、数组转成字符串的基本操作 在 JS 中,将数组转成字符串是一项最基本但也最常见的操作之一。我们可以使用 Array 类型内置的 join() 方法实现。它将数组的元素连接成一个…

    编程 2025-04-25

发表回复

登录后才能评论